CSS是用于定義網頁樣式的語言,其中的指示符是CSS中非常重要的一部分,它們用于指定元素的樣式、顏色、邊框、內邊距等等。本文將介紹CSS中的指示符的基本概念、用法和注意事項。
一、基本概念
在CSS中,指示符是用于指定元素的樣式的參數,它們以!</>號開頭,后面的參數用于指定元素的樣式。指示符可以分為兩大類:類指示符和屬性指示符。
1. 類指示符
類指示符用于定義一類元素的樣式,其語法為:</>class_name:</>style_type>
其中,class_name是類名,style_type是樣式類型,如:
- 行內樣式:style_type="text/css";
- 塊樣式:style_type="text/css";
- 偽類樣式:style_type="display: flex;";
類指示符可以包含多個屬性,每個屬性的值用大寫字母和小寫字母組成。例如:
.box {
width: 300px;
height: 300px;
background-color: #fff;
border: 1px solid #ccc;
上面的代碼定義了一個名為“box”的類,它有兩個屬性:width和height,分別對應元素的寬度和高度,背景顏色為白色,邊框和內邊距也分別對應元素的寬度和高度。
2. 屬性指示符
屬性指示符用于指定元素的屬性值,其語法為:</>name:</>value>
其中,name是屬性名,value是屬性值。例如:
.box {
width: 300px;
height: 300px;
background-color: #fff;
border: 1px solid #ccc;
padding: 20px;
上面的代碼定義了一個名為“padding”的屬性,它的值為20px。
二、用法和注意事項
1. 類指示符
使用類指示符可以方便地定義一類元素的樣式,其語法如下:
<style>
<class_name>元素樣式</class_name>
</style>
.box {
width: 300px;
height: 300px;
background-color: #fff;
border: 1px solid #ccc;
上面的代碼定義了一個名為“box”的類,它有兩個屬性:width和height,分別對應元素的寬度和高度,背景顏色為白色,邊框和內邊距也分別對應元素的寬度和高度。
2. 屬性指示符
使用屬性指示符可以指定元素的某一屬性值,其語法如下:
<style>
<name>屬性值</name>
</style>
.box {
width: 300px;
height: 300px;
background-color: #fff;
border: 1px solid #ccc;
padding: 20px;
.box p {
font-size: 16px;
上面的代碼定義了一個名為“padding”的屬性,它的值為20px,同時還定義了一個名為“p”的類,它的樣式為font-size:16px。
3. 偽類指示符
偽類指示符用于定義一系列偽類,其語法如下:</>class_name:</>style_type>
.flex-container {
display: flex;
flex-direction: column;
.justify-content: space-between;
上面的代碼定義了一個名為“justify-content”的偽類,它的樣式為flex-direction: column,表示元素的內容應該按照行進行排列,而“space-between”則表示在中間添加一條內邊距。
CSS中的指示符是CSS中非常重要的一部分,它們用于指定元素的樣式,包括寬度、高度、顏色、邊框、內邊距等等。使用類指示符可以方便地定義一類元素的樣式,使用屬性指示符可以指定元素的某一屬性值,同時偽類指示符也可以幫助定義一系列偽類。在CSS中,正確地使用指示符可以讓網頁更加美觀、易于閱讀,提高用戶體驗。